Wie kann ich Pakete mit pip gemäß der Datei „requirements.txt“ aus einem lokalen Verzeichnis installieren?Python

Python-Programme
Anonymous
 Wie kann ich Pakete mit pip gemäß der Datei „requirements.txt“ aus einem lokalen Verzeichnis installieren?

Post by Anonymous »

Hier ist das Problem:
Ich habe eine Datei „requirements.txt, die wie folgt aussieht:

Code: Select all

BeautifulSoup==3.2.0
Django==1.3
Fabric==1.2.0
Jinja2==2.5.5
PyYAML==3.09
Pygments==1.4
SQLAlchemy==0.7.1
South==0.7.3
amqplib==0.6.1
anyjson==0.3
...
Ich habe ein lokales Archivverzeichnis, das alle Pakete + andere enthält.
Ich habe eine neue virtuelle Umgebung mit
erstellt

Code: Select all

bin/virtualenv testing
Nach der Aktivierung habe ich versucht, die Pakete gemäß „requirements.txt“ aus dem lokalen Archivverzeichnis zu installieren.

Code: Select all

source bin/activate
pip install -r /path/to/requirements.txt -f file:///path/to/archive/
Ich habe eine Ausgabe erhalten, die darauf hindeutet, dass die Installation in Ordnung ist:

Code: Select all

Downloading/unpacking Fabric==1.2.0 (from -r ../testing/requirements.txt (line 3))
Running setup.py egg_info for package Fabric
warning: no previously-included files matching '*' found under directory 'docs/_build'
warning: no files found matching 'fabfile.py'
Downloading/unpacking South==0.7.3 (from -r ../testing/requirements.txt (line 8))
Running setup.py egg_info for package South
....
Eine spätere Überprüfung ergab jedoch, dass keines der Pakete ordnungsgemäß installiert war. Ich kann die Pakete nicht importieren und es werden keine im Site-Packages-Verzeichnis meiner virtuellen Umgebung gefunden. Was ist also schief gelaufen?

Quick Reply

Change Text Case: 
   
  • Similar Topics
    Replies
    Views
    Last post